Product Description:
Bender Communication Interfaces are high-reliability gateway and interface modules designed to bridge specialized electrical safety monitoring systems—such as insulation monitoring devices (IMDs) and residual current monitors (RCMs)—with higher-level industrial control and automation networks. These devices convert proprietary data from Bender device buses into standard industrial communication protocols, enabling real-time monitoring of electrical insulation levels, leakage currents, and system faults from a central control room or SCADA system.
The technical profile of a Bender Communication Interface focuses on industrial protocol conversion and precise data telemetry:
Field Side Protocols: Supports Bender proprietary communication networks, primarily the COM441 or internal device buses, to gather data from individual monitoring devices.
Network Side Protocols: Converts field data into industry-standard open protocols including Modbus TCP/IP, Modbus RTU, Profibus DP, Profinet, and BACnet/IP.
Interface Ports: Equipped with RJ45 ports for industrial Ethernet connections and screw terminal blocks for RS-485 serial connections.
Power Supply: Typically operates on standard control voltages, ranging from 24V DC up to 240V AC/DC depending on the specific model variation.
Data Capacity: Capable of networking multiple measuring devices—often up to 30 or 100 devices depending on the interface model—under a single IP address or bus node.
Web Integration: Features integrated web server capabilities on Ethernet-enabled models, supporting standard HTTP or HTTPS protocols for direct browser access.
Bender Communication Interfaces provide distinct benefits for predictive maintenance and facility management:
Centralized Safety Visibility: Allows facility operators to view insulation resistance values and residual leakage currents across an entire plant from a single dashboard, transforming isolated safety devices into an integrated monitoring network.
Early Warning Alerts: Transmits pre-alarm and alarm signals instantly to the control network, enabling maintenance teams to locate and fix insulation degradation before a catastrophic ground fault occurs.
Simplified Configuration: Built-in web servers allow for easy device parameter assignment, testing, and troubleshooting via a standard web browser, eliminating the need for specialized configuration software.
Galvanic Isolation: Provides strong electrical isolation between the sensitive plant-wide industrial network and the electrical safety bus, preventing local electrical faults from disrupting plant communications.
Comprehensive Data Logging: Supports automated data archiving and trending for insulation values, making it easier to track the long-term health of electrical infrastructure and generate regulatory compliance reports.
These interfaces are critical components in industries where electrical uptime and safety are paramount:
Healthcare Facilities: Integrating medical isolated power system monitors (IPS) in operating rooms into the central building management system (BMS) for continuous safety monitoring.
Renewable Energy Installations: Connecting insulation monitoring devices from large-scale solar photovoltaic arrays and wind turbines to supervisory control networks.
Data Centers: Monitoring continuous residual leakage currents in critical power distribution units (PDUs) to prevent unexpected server room trips.
Maritime and Offshore: Bridging ungrounded electrical systems on ships and oil platforms with the main vessel management system to ensure safe operation at sea.
E-Mobility Infrastructure: Managing the communication from isolation monitoring circuits inside high-power electric vehicle charging stations back to the network provider.
To ensure reliable data transmission and accurate safety reporting, the following precautions must be observed:
Network Segmentation: When utilizing Modbus TCP or web server functions, ensure the communication interface is placed behind a secure firewall or on a dedicated automation VLAN to protect the safety system from unauthorized cyber access.
Bus Termination: For RS-485 serial networks or Bender device buses, proper termination resistors must be activated or installed at the physical ends of the communication line to prevent signal reflection and data corruption.
Addressing Integrity: Carefully assign unique bus addresses to each connected measuring device before linking them through the interface module, as duplicate addresses will cause severe data conflicts and loss of visibility.
Shielding Practices: Always use high-quality shielded twisted-pair cabling for all serial communication lines. The shield should be grounded properly at a single point to prevent high-frequency electrical noise from corrupting data packets.
Voltage Verification: Ensure that the power supply wiring to the communication interface matches the exact rating indicated on the device nameplate, as overvoltage can permanently damage the internal logic circuits.
